Located on the University of Nevada, Reno campus is the Clark Administration Building, formerly known as the Library of the University of Nevada, erected in 1926.
Dedicated in October 1927, this building was originally the Alice McManus Clark Library and was to replace a temporary library, which is now the Jones Center. The building, designed by Robert D. Farquhar of Los Angeles, was donated to the University by William Andrews Clark Jr., in memory of his wife, Alice McManus Clark. The building houses the President’s Office, Provost’s Office, as well as the Offices of University Vice Presidents for Student Services and Administration and Finance, the Divisions of Planning, Budget and Analysis, Student Life and the President’s Special Assistant for Diversity. Additionally, it houses the Office of Student Judicial Affairs and offices for Student Transition Programs. ~source
